The code I want to use this for is in a directory with several
subdirectories. One is BIN which contains the executable.

Currently there is an environment variable needed that points to the
main directory. If I can read out the absolute path to the executable
I can retrieve the locations to all the subdirectories without needing
an environment variable for that. I hope this will be more reliable
than having the user set the environment variable as needed.
